Gusto Pricing
Gusto costs from $40/mo up to $80/mo — about $480/year at the entry tier. There are 3 plans, and no free tier. That is above the $29/mo average for HR tools we track.

Hidden costs to budget for
- • Per-seat plans multiply with team size — check whether the price above is per user.
- • Headline prices usually assume annual billing; paying monthly costs more.
- • Premium support, extra storage, and higher API limits are common paid add-ons.
- • Watch for renewal pricing: introductory rates often rise at the second term.
